Background Info: the first "third-party" Combustion v2 Training Book to hit the market will be called "Combustion Ground Rules" written by Todd Petersen - published by Delmar Learning and scheduled for release in October 2002.

As for the author, his full name is Michael Todd Peterson, but he likes to go by the name of Todd Petersen. He is the owner of MTP Grafx, an animation firm located in Lousinana, that specializes in architectural animation, forensics, and multimedia. He has lectured Computer Architecture at his old school, University of Tennessee, where he achieved a Bachelor of Architecture in 1992. His MTP Grafx website is located at http://www.mtpgrafx.com/ where you can find background info and samples of his work.
Todd Petersen is also Senior Product Manager at Digimation in St. Rose, Louisiana, where he is in charge of many of the plug-ins for the 3ds max market. He serves as head of tech support and Systems admininstrator/webmaster and he supports a variety of the Digimation websites, including www.digimation.com, newsletters.digimation.com, www.maxusers.com, and beta.digimation.com.
In addition to the upcoming "Combustion Ground Rules" book, Todd has authored many other books, including "3D Studio MAX Fundamentals" and "3D Studio MAX 2 Fundamentals", and has contributed to "Inside AutoCAD 14," "Inside 3D Studio MAX Volume II," and "Inside 3D Studio MAX Volume III," all from New Riders Publishing.
